Home
last modified time | relevance | path

Searched refs:crypto_provider_handle_t (Results 1 – 6 of 6) sorted by relevance

/f-stack/freebsd/contrib/openzfs/module/icp/include/sys/crypto/
H A Dspi.h56 typedef void *crypto_provider_handle_t; typedef
89 crypto_provider_handle_t cc_provider;
139 int (*create_ctx_template)(crypto_provider_handle_t,
251 int (*sign_recover_atomic)(crypto_provider_handle_t,
282 int (*verify_recover_atomic)(crypto_provider_handle_t,
346 int (*mac_decrypt_atomic)(crypto_provider_handle_t,
419 int (*object_find)(crypto_provider_handle_t, void *,
460 int (*ext_info)(crypto_provider_handle_t,
471 int (*copyin_mechanism)(crypto_provider_handle_t,
473 int (*copyout_mechanism)(crypto_provider_handle_t,
[all …]
H A Dimpl.h213 crypto_provider_handle_t pd_prov_handle;
1240 int crypto_seed_random(crypto_provider_handle_t provider, uchar_t *buf,
1242 int crypto_generate_random(crypto_provider_handle_t provider, uchar_t *buf,
1250 int crypto_init_token(crypto_provider_handle_t provider, char *pin,
1252 int crypto_init_pin(crypto_provider_handle_t provider, char *pin,
1254 int crypto_set_pin(crypto_provider_handle_t provider, char *old_pin,
/f-stack/freebsd/contrib/openzfs/module/icp/io/
H A Dskein_mod.c74 static void skein_provider_status(crypto_provider_handle_t, uint_t *);
86 static int skein_digest_atomic(crypto_provider_handle_t, crypto_session_id_t,
101 static int skein_mac_atomic(crypto_provider_handle_t, crypto_session_id_t,
114 static int skein_create_ctx_template(crypto_provider_handle_t,
256 skein_provider_status(crypto_provider_handle_t provider, uint_t *status) in skein_provider_status()
543 skein_digest_atomic(crypto_provider_handle_t provider, in skein_digest_atomic()
651 skein_mac_atomic(crypto_provider_handle_t provider, in skein_mac_atomic()
692 skein_create_ctx_template(crypto_provider_handle_t provider, in skein_create_ctx_template()
H A Dsha1_mod.c100 static void sha1_provider_status(crypto_provider_handle_t, uint_t *);
114 static int sha1_digest_atomic(crypto_provider_handle_t, crypto_session_id_t,
132 static int sha1_mac_atomic(crypto_provider_handle_t, crypto_session_id_t,
135 static int sha1_mac_verify_atomic(crypto_provider_handle_t, crypto_session_id_t,
148 static int sha1_create_ctx_template(crypto_provider_handle_t,
232 sha1_provider_status(crypto_provider_handle_t provider, uint_t *status) in sha1_provider_status()
566 sha1_digest_atomic(crypto_provider_handle_t provider, in sha1_digest_atomic()
882 sha1_mac_atomic(crypto_provider_handle_t provider, in sha1_mac_atomic()
998 sha1_mac_verify_atomic(crypto_provider_handle_t provider, in sha1_mac_verify_atomic()
1152 sha1_create_ctx_template(crypto_provider_handle_t provider, in sha1_create_ctx_template()
H A Dsha2_mod.c127 static void sha2_provider_status(crypto_provider_handle_t, uint_t *);
141 static int sha2_digest_atomic(crypto_provider_handle_t, crypto_session_id_t,
159 static int sha2_mac_atomic(crypto_provider_handle_t, crypto_session_id_t,
162 static int sha2_mac_verify_atomic(crypto_provider_handle_t, crypto_session_id_t,
175 static int sha2_create_ctx_template(crypto_provider_handle_t,
259 sha2_provider_status(crypto_provider_handle_t provider, uint_t *status) in sha2_provider_status()
623 sha2_digest_atomic(crypto_provider_handle_t provider, in sha2_digest_atomic()
988 sha2_mac_atomic(crypto_provider_handle_t provider, in sha2_mac_atomic()
1126 sha2_mac_verify_atomic(crypto_provider_handle_t provider, in sha2_mac_verify_atomic()
1306 sha2_create_ctx_template(crypto_provider_handle_t provider, in sha2_create_ctx_template()
H A Daes.c95 static void aes_provider_status(crypto_provider_handle_t, uint_t *);
118 static int aes_encrypt_atomic(crypto_provider_handle_t, crypto_session_id_t,
126 static int aes_decrypt_atomic(crypto_provider_handle_t, crypto_session_id_t,
143 static int aes_mac_atomic(crypto_provider_handle_t, crypto_session_id_t,
159 static int aes_create_ctx_template(crypto_provider_handle_t,
316 aes_provider_status(crypto_provider_handle_t provider, uint_t *status) in aes_provider_status()
934 aes_encrypt_atomic(crypto_provider_handle_t provider, in aes_encrypt_atomic()
1070 aes_decrypt_atomic(crypto_provider_handle_t provider, in aes_decrypt_atomic()
1240 aes_create_ctx_template(crypto_provider_handle_t provider, in aes_create_ctx_template()
1416 aes_mac_atomic(crypto_provider_handle_t provider, in aes_mac_atomic()
[all …]